“…The abrupt changes in the North Atlantic climate have been associated with changes in the Atlantic meridional overturning circulation (AMOC) (McManus et al, 1999;Elliot et al, 2002;McManus et al, 2004;Stocker and Johnsen, 2003). The Asian monsoon, which is sensitive to orbitally controlled changes of insolation (Xiao et al, 1999;Rousseau and Kukla, 2000) also varied on millennial timescales as shown by speleothem (Wang et al, 2001) and marine sediment (Altabet et al, 2002) records. The Indian monsoon has also been suggested to vary on these timescales.…”
